Add Business
Report Changes
US Locations
Home
Rhode Island
Jamestown
Post Offices
Post Offices in Jamestown, Rhode Island
1
locations found near Jamestown
View Map
1
United States Postal Service
109 Narragansett Ave, Jamestown Ri 02835
(401) 423-0420
Post Offices in Other Cities
Post Offices in Coventry, Rhode Island
Post Offices in Prudence Island, Rhode Island
Post Offices in Woonsocket, Rhode Island
Find a location
Search
Other Categories
Auto Repair
Banks
Clothing Stores
Gas Stations
Gift Shops
Gyms
Hardware Stores
Jewelry Stores
Liquor Stores
Other
Pet Stores
Shipping Centers
Supermarkets
Veterinarians